Edison opens hydrogen/gas power station in Venice On Friday, the Italian energy company Edison (EDNn.MI) opened a cutting-edge power plant in Venice that uses natural gas and hydrogen gas to reduce hazardous emissions. The government of Italy views the production of electricity from hydrogen as a viable alternative for a nation that now generates more than 50% of its energy by burning coal, oil, and natural gas as it works to minimize pollution.
